Best Buy Up Over 15%, on Pace for Largest Percent Increase Since March 2020 -- Data Talk

Dow Jones
May 28

Best Buy Co., Inc. $(BBY)$ is currently at $74.60, up $10.06 or 15.59%

 

--Would be highest close since Dec. 11, 2025, when it closed at $74.97

--On pace for largest percent increase since March 24, 2020, when it rose 16.79%

--Currently up nine of the past 10 days

--Currently up eight consecutive days; up 32.55% over this period

--Longest winning streak since Jan. 4, 2022, when it rose for eight straight trading days

--Best eight-day stretch since the eight days ending Jan. 22, 2013, when it rose 32.79%

--Up 23.33% month-to-date; on pace for best month since Nov. 2022, when it rose 24.69%

--Up 11.46% year-to-date

--Down 45.94% from its all-time closing high of $138.00 on Nov. 22, 2021

--Up 12.48% from 52 weeks ago (May 29, 2025), when it closed at $66.32

--Down 11.19% from its 52-week closing high of $84.00 on Oct. 29, 2025

--Up 34.37% from its 52-week closing low of $55.52 on May 13, 2026

--Traded as high as $74.77; highest intraday level since Dec. 12, 2025, when it hit $76.02

--Up 15.85% at today's intraday high; largest intraday percent increase since Aug. 29, 2024, when it rose as much as 18.13%

--Third best performer in the S&P 500 today

 

All data as of 10:41:05 AM ET

 

Source: Dow Jones Market Data, FactSet
